Eco-Friendliness
Unlike modern artificial knapsacks, canvas is made with naturally sustainable and lasting materials like cotton and hemp. It's likewise eco-friendly and eco-friendly, making it an excellent choice for your next outdoor camping journey.
Along with being durable and eco-friendly, canvas is also breathable. This enables air to flow inside your bag, keeping it dry and protecting against moisture buildup. This is particularly vital for backpacking, where your pack will be exposed to extreme problems.
The textile of a canvas backpack is also an excellent insulator, aiding to keep your gear cozy. The firmly woven fibers assist to shield, while the all-natural breathability helps to regulate your temperature.
One drawback of canvas knapsacks is that they're usually heavier than modern synthetic bags. This is since the material is thicker and extra largely woven. In addition, canvas doesn't dry as rapidly as synthetic materials, so it can be susceptible to mold and mildew and mold. Nonetheless, this is generally a small issue, as many canvas knapsacks include rainfall covers to stop water damage.
Water Resistant
A canvas knapsack is ideal for camping because it safeguards your gear from the components. It's important that the bag has sufficient room to store all your fundamentals, and it fits to lug for lengthy trips. A padded back support and flexible bands help prevent shoulder stress. It's likewise a good idea to get a pack with a water resistant cover, in case you come across rain during your journey.
A quality canvas knapsack will certainly have taped seams and sealed zippers to stop water access. You can likewise use a safety coating or wax coating to boost the pack's water resistance. A few of these items are offered as sprays, which you can make use of to treat high-exposure locations. Others are more irreversible, calling for only occasional reapplication.
The ideal treatment and maintenance will keep your backpack looking great for years to find. Routine cleaning and mindful handling will certainly ensure that your backpack awaits your following adventure. Be sure to prevent fabric softener and make use of a mild cleaning agent for the best outcomes. After cleaning, let your knapsack dry in a shaded location to stay clear of color fading.

When choosing a canvas backpack, think about the ability, which is how much gear it can hold. You'll desire a knapsack that can accommodate all of your outdoor camping equipment. Relying on your trip length and equipment, you might require a big knapsack or a tiny one.
Most canvas backpacks start with woven cotton or cotton-polyester blends evaluating 8-16 oz per square yard to stabilize sturdiness and comfort.
